Freeze-dried rabies vaccines for human use are critical in combating rabies, especially in China. This vaccine form enhances stability and shelf-life. A report from the World Health Organization states that rabies causes approximately 59,000 deaths annually, predominantly in Asia and Africa. In areas where rabies is endemic, effective vaccination programs are vital.
The freeze-dried formulation allows for easier transportation and storage, requiring no refrigeration until reconstitution. Research indicates that the effectiveness of freeze-dried vaccines can remain intact for years when stored properly. However, the need for skilled personnel to administer these vaccines is essential. A significant percentage of administered vaccines lose potency due to improper handling.
Data from various studies suggest that access to these vaccines in rural areas remains a challenge. Vaccination campaigns must overcome logistical hurdles, such as storage conditions. Ensuring that healthcare workers are thoroughly trained is crucial. Despite advancements in freeze-dried technology, unintentional mistakes during the vaccination process continue to occur. Emphasis on training and community awareness may bridge these gaps in vaccine distribution and efficacy.

Rabies remains a critical public health concern in China. The distribution and access to effective rabies vaccines face significant challenges. According to a report by the World Health Organization (WHO), rabies causes approximately 60,000 deaths annually worldwide. In China, the demand for rabies vaccinations has increased, particularly in rural areas where dog bites are more prevalent.
Access to vaccines is limited in remote regions. Infrastructure issues hinder effective distribution. Many local health facilities lack cold chain systems, resulting in vaccine spoilage. A study indicated that over 30% of vaccines are wasted due to improper storage. This loss exacerbates the existing public health crisis. Increasing awareness is vital for better access to vaccines.
Tips for improving access include advocating for local health resources. Community workshops can educate about rabies preventive measures. Strengthening cold chain logistics is also crucial. Collaborations with organizations that specialize in health distribution can enhance regional outreach. Addressing these gaps requires concerted efforts from health officials, stakeholders, and communities.
